How To make Fillet Of Sole with Broccoli
1/4 c Butter or margarine
1/4 c Unsifted all-purpose flour
1 t Salt
1 t Dried tarragon leaves
1/8 t Pepper
1 c Milk
1/4 c Dry white wine
1/4 c Water
20 oz Frozen chopped broccoli
2 T Lemon juice
32 oz Frozen flounder fillets,
-thawed Lemon juice Salt and pepper 2 T Parmesan cheese.
1. In a medium-sized, heat-resistant, non-metallic bowl, heat butter in
Microwave Oven 1 minute or until melted. 2. Add flour, salt, tarragon leaves and pepper. Stir until smooth. Add
milk, a little at a time, stirring after each addition Heat, uncovered, in Microwave Oven 4 minutes or until thickened and smooth. 3. Stir in wine. Heat, uncovered, an additional 2 minutes in Microwave
Oven. Set sauce aside. 4. In a deep, 1 1/2-quart, heat-resistant, non-metallic casserole place 1/4
cup water and chopped broccoli. Heat, covered, in Microwave Oven 3 minutes. Stir. Heat, covered, an additional 3 minutes in Microwave Oven or until broccoli is heated through Drain excess water. 5. Add 1 cup of sauce and 2 tablespoons lemon juice to cooked broccoli,
mixing gently to combine. 6. Brush fillets with lemon juice and sprinkle with salt and pepper, to
taste. 7. Arrange fillets in a 3-quart, heat-resistant, non-metallic baking dish,
with fillets overlapping. Spoon broccoli mixture around the edge of fillets. Spoon remaining sauce over fish. 8. Heat, uncovered, in Microwave Oven for 9 minutes. Sprinkle Parmesan
cheese over top of fish and heat, uncovered, an addi- tional 5 minutes in Microwave Oven or until cheese is melted.

How to Make Martha Stewart’s Sole a la Meuniere | Martha’s Cooking School | Martha Stewart
A classic French dish that’s easy-to-make and perfect for a fancy dinner date. In this video, Martha Stewart shows you how to make sole a la meuniere with a Dover sole. She starts by skinning and trimming the fish before dredging both sides of it in flour, which has a little salt and pepper in the mixture. Next, after adding clarified butter to a pan, she cooks both sides of the fish evenly. Finally, she adds normal butter to the pan and spoons it over the fish before topping with parsley and freshly squeezed lemon juice. She filets the meat off of the bone and enjoys the rich and savory flavor of this simple but delicious recipe.

One Pan Lemon Garlic Baked Cod w/ Potatoes & Asparagus
Cod doesn't get enough love! It's lean, protein-packed, light, flakey and tastes amazing!????????????????
This right here makes an easy healthy quick delicious meal in around 30 minutes from start to finish all on one pan!
Efficient and effective! ????
FULL RECIPE ⬇️
INGREDIENTS
- 1 large wild caught Cod fillet
- ~3 cups fresh chopped asparagus
(~1 in pieces, make sure to remove the bottoms)
- ~3 cups baby red potatoes cut into quarters
- Extra virgin olive oil
- Seasonings: salt, pepper, Flavor God Garlic Lovers, Flavor God Lemon & Garlic.
(Link + discount code in bio)
DIRECTIONS
1. Cut the potatoes and add to a large mixing bowl. Add in olive oil, salt, pepper and Flavor God Garlic Lovers. Give a good toss then place on a baking sheet lined w/ parchment paper. Place in the oven at 400 for ~15 minutes.
2. While the potatoes are in the oven, Prep the asparagus and the cod. Cut the asparagus and add to the large mixing bowl. Add in olive oil, salt, pepper and Flavor God Lemon & Garlic. Give a good toss. Cut the cod into smaller fillets.
3. Once the ~15 minutes are up, remove the potatoes and add the asparagus to the pan. Mix and create slots for the Cod then add those next. Hit the cod with a olive oil and season the same as the asparagus. Add a slice of lemon on top of each one then place back in the oven for ~12-15 minutes or until largest piece hits 145 degrees internal.
4. Remove from oven, garnish with chopped parsley and extra lemon juice.

Tilapia Fillet Recipe
Tilapia recipes | Tilapia fillet recipe
Today I’m sharing my easy pan seared tilapia recipe! This recipe will give you fish that is crispy on the outside and perfectly flaky and delicious on the inside! Cook my tilapia recipe on a weeknight for a quick, delicious and easy dinner!
________________________________
INGREDIENTS:
2 large tilapia fillets
1 tbsp olive oil
2 tbsp butter
2 garlic cloves
1/4 lemon
Parsley for garnish
Dry Batter:
2 tbsp all purpose flour
1/4 tsp salt
1/4 tsp black pepper
1/4 tsp red chilli flakes
1/2 tsp dried oregano
1/4 tsp dried thyme
METHOD:
1. Clean and pat dry 2 large tilapia fillets. Sprinkle with a pinch of salt and set aside for 5 mins
2. In a plate, mix all the ingredients mentioned under dry batter. Coat the fish on both sides with the dry batter and gently shake off excess
3. On low flame, heat 1 tbsp olive oil in a skillet/wide pan and infuse it with 2 crushed garlic cloves. Once the garlic starts to brown, remove it from the pan. This way we get a subtle garlic flavor in the dish
4. Next melt 2 tbsp butter in the oil. If using salted, don't add salt to the dry batter or it might end up too salty
5. Set flame to medium and gently place the fish. Fry for 3-4 mins per side. Be careful while flipping as it can break easily
6. Once the fish is done, squeeze the juice of 1/4 lemon all over and garnish with fresh parsley
7. Serve these delicious pan fried Tilapia fillets with sautéed veggies or a salad
________________________________
SUBSTITUTES:
• What other fish can be used?
Bass, cod, snapper, halibut
• Can prawns be used?
Yes
• No parsley?
Coriander/cilantro can also be used
• No dried oregano/thyme?
Use 1 tsp mixed herbs/Italian seasoning
• No red chilli flakes
Use red chilli powder
________________________________
TIPS:
• Be careful while flipping the fish as it can break
• Adding lemon juice at the end helps cut the richness of the butter
• Store leftover dry batter in an airtight container in the freezer and use it the next time you make this recipe
